2008 Fall Marathon Training Series
at Big Dry Creek Trail, Westminster

July 20, 2008 7:00AM - 10 miles
August 3, 2008 7:00AM - 15 miles
August 24, 2008 7:00AM - 20 miles
September 14, 2008 7:00AM - 20 miles

Fully-supported long runs that fit perfectly in training schedules for Boulder Marathon, the Denver Marathon, Chicago, and other fall full- and half-marathons.

Courses are 80% hard-packed dirt, 20% concrete, with occasional mild hills. Course markings every mile. Aid stations with water, electrolyte drinks, and energy bars or gels every 2-3 miles. Post-race food and drinks, awards for top 3 males and females.
